
Cill Stuifín
Off the coast of West Clare lies Cill Stuifín, a village long believed to have been swallowed by the sea - some say by a freak wave, others by an ancient curse. In this cinematic documentary, folklorist Aindrias de Staic follows in his late father's footsteps to uncover the truth behind the legend. As haunting stories collide with scientific discoveries, geologists reveal evidence of a cataclysmic event, while big wave surfers confront the powerful reef that guards its secrets.
